The Return of the Black Knight

Onvo, a subsidiary of Nio, has made a strategic decision to bring back its limited-edition L60 Black Knight model. This move is a departure from the initial launch in December 2025, where the vehicle was offered in limited quantities, with only 666 units available. Now, the Black Knight edition will be a regular offering, suggesting a shift in Onvo's sales strategy.

What makes this particularly fascinating is the timing. Onvo's decision comes at a time when the brand is facing sales challenges. February saw a decline in deliveries, impacted by the Chinese New Year holiday. So, why bring back a limited-edition model as a regular offering? Market Competition and Consumer Incentives

The highly competitive mid-size SUV market is a key factor in Onvo's decision. With the L60 being a crucial product for Nio's expansion into the mainstream family market, every sales boost counts. To further enhance its appeal, Onvo is offering promotional policies, including tax subsidies and ultra-low-interest loan plans. These incentives are designed to attract family users and drive sales in the short term.
